Ardenfeld Logistics has proposed a 50/50 joint venture covering cold-chain distribution in the Varemont corridor. Their fleet and depots complement our Fjordline warehousing assets. Key open items: governance split, IP ownership on routing software, exit provisions. Legal review is underway; finance modeling suggests breakeven within three years. Prior leadership deferred a decision pending this quarter's results. Recommendation to follow after due diligence closes. The confidential note below outlines the strategic intent.

board note of fahog-bawep: The renewal with Holixax Holdings closes at $20 million a year, 20 percent below the last contract. Project Druwyn slips by two quarters because of the supplier delay.

### Changelog — Bramleaf Calendar Sync v4.2

Changed defaults for conflict resolution. Previously, overlapping edits from two connected calendars silently preferred the remote copy, which caused lost local changes. The new default prompts a merge and records both versions. Reviewers should confirm the behavior matches the new default configuration listed below.

config for kafof-bawef:
holath:
  log_level: debug
  metrics_host: metrics.holath.qorvelsys.internal
  pin: 2191
  pool_size: 32

Before approving changes to the export-retry path in Pellwork's Driftline service, please verify that the backoff schedule caps at six attempts and that partial files are always deleted before a retry begins. Reviewers should also run the staging replay harness, which exercises every failure class we've catalogued. The harness pulls fixtures from the sealed snapshot bucket, and that bucket is encrypted at rest. To decrypt it locally, the harness prompts for the team recovery passphrase, which is provided below.

vault phrase of bagaf-kajeg = jorath-feniel-briir-siliel-ralix